Most Delicious Ways to Eat More BerriesBerries are among the healthiest fruits you can eat daily to improve your health. They are bright, flavorful and incredibly sweet superfruits, which are high in Vitamin C, antioxidants and fiber, and low in sugar. While it’s great to snack on berries plain or add them to your smoothies, there are a few more unique and delicious way to eat more berries on a daily basis.

Ways to Break a Habit of Judging OthersHave you ever tried to live at least a few minutes without judging someone? I believe it’s a great pleasure and happiness to be free from judgment. Unfortunately, we are all judgmental in a certain way. The human nature to be judgmental causes interpersonal barriers and hatred, creating some kind of division between people.
There are so many different nationalities and cultures that it’s sometimes hard to suppress the desire to judge somebody, because they are different. I know that everyone finds themselves the best and the most special, but if you want to avoid being judgmental, you should stop comparing yourself to someone else. You’d better pay attention to your own failures and try to state a clear idea of how you should lead your life.
Dietrich Bonhoeffer once said a wise thing, “By judging others we blind ourselves to our own evil and to the grace which others are just as entitled to as we are.” Here are a few tips to follow if you want to break a habit of judging people around you.
